Imagine yourself being a busy Japanese man walking through the streets or at festivals of Japan. One of the most famous fast food there is takoyaki - a kind of dumpling, made of grilled puffs of seasoned batter with a piece of octopus meat in the middle, with sauces and spices along the top. Besides octopus, it is usually filled with tempura scraps, pickled ginger, and green onion. Food and Drinks cursor with delicious Takoyaki.

